Boot ROM Validation engineer

2 - 7 years

10 - 20 Lacs

Posted:1 month ago| Platform: Naukri logo

Apply

Work Mode

Work from Office

Job Type

Full Time

Job Description

  • Role: Sr. Boot ROM Validation engineer
  • Location: Hyderabad
  • Work from office
  • Experience: 2-10 years
  • Bachelors Degree in engineering or related domain
  • Project:
  • BootROM is a crucial firmware component in SoCs, responsible for loading the first-stage boot loader. Unlike standard ROMs, this BootROM is more complex in nature. Its key responsibility includes establishing the Root of Trust using advanced security algorithms for authentication and confidentiality. Examples of these algorithms include RSA, ECDSA, AES, and others.
  • The primary responsibility is the validation of BootROM, which includes the following tasks

    :
  • 1.Develop and execute test cases to validate all boot peripherals from where the FSBL (First Stage Boot Loader) is copied. Example: xSPI, SD, eMMC, UFS, USB
  • 2.Create and execute test cases to validate all proprietary boot sequences.
  • 3.Develop and execute test cases to validate all internal boot modes.
  • 4.Write and run test cases to validate all supported authentication algorithms.
  • 5.Develop and execute test cases to validate all supported encryption/decryption algorithms.
  • 6.Automate tests using Python.
  • Perform testing on prototyping/emulation platforms, including X86 emulation.
  • 7.Identify, document, and track issues using JIRA.
  • Report coverage metrics using tools such as Verdi and add tests to ensure maximum source line coverage.
  • Review requirements and create associated test cases to ensure traceability.
  • Collaborate with different teams to resolve any blockers.
  • Engage in constructive discussions with the design team to improve the quality of the BootROM.
  • Conduct security threat analysis using internal tools.
  • Adhere to safety processes while performing the above tasks.
  • Mock Interview

    Practice Video Interview with JobPe AI

    Start Python Interview
    cta

    Start Your Job Search Today

    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

    Job Application AI Bot

    Job Application AI Bot

    Apply to 20+ Portals in one click

    Download Now

    Download the Mobile App

    Instantly access job listings, apply easily, and track applications.

    coding practice

    Enhance Your Python Skills

    Practice Python coding challenges to boost your skills

    Start Practicing Python Now

    RecommendedJobs for You

    pollachi, salem, coimbatore, erode

    pollachi, salem, coimbatore, erode